WebMar 15, 2024 · Come to the Edge (Christopher Logue) Come to the edge. We might fall. Come to the edge. It’s too high! COME TO THE EDGE! And they came, And he pushed, And they flew. Note: This simple, powerful poem is the work of Christopher Logue (1926 – 2011), an English poet known for his short, pithy and often political poems. WebEdge computing is a distributed information technology (IT) architecture in which client data is processed at the periphery of the network, as close to the originating source as possible. The move toward edge computing is driven by mobile computing, the decreasing cost of computer components and the sheer number of networked devices in the ...

WebJan 25, 2024 · Push the limit. All right, today’s expression is push the limit. It means trying to do a little more than what’s allowed, without suffering consequences. If you have kids, or if you’ve ever been a kid, you probably know what it means to push the limit.
